#445520 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#445520 is composed of 26.7% red, 33.3%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.4%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 79.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.3% and a lightness of 22.9%. #445520 color hex could be obtained by blending #88aa40 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#445520 color description : Very dark green.
#445520 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#445520 has RGB values of R:68, G:85,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 4478240.
